The Bullets took the lead for good with a 10-0 run which gave them a 19-10 lead on a three-pointer by Matt Whelan with 9:54 to play in the first half. Gettysburg took a 34-27 lead into halftime and extended the lead to as many as 22 points in the second half.
Glaser went 10-for-13 from the field, one-of-two from beyond the three-point arc, and three-of-four from the free throw line en route to his 24 points. Mike Spadafora added 11 points for Gettysburg, while Ryan Page came off the bench to contribute 12 points for the Bullets.
Junior guard Kyle Stem led the Shoremen with 17 points and converted 13-of-14 free throw attempts. Junior forward Jonathan Webb added 16 points in the loss for Washington.
Gettysburg shot 54% from the field in the game, including a 61% mark in the second half. Washington shot 37% from the field in the game.
